HU16 4QQ lies on Apple Tree Walk in Cottingham. HU16 4QQ is located in the Cottingham South electoral ward, within the unitary authority of East Riding of Yorkshire and the English Parliamentary constituency of Haltemprice and Howden.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Humber and North Yorkshire ICB - 02Y and the police force is Humberside. This postcode has been in use since June 1996.
